Wang Xianyuan (Chinese: 王憲嫄; 427[4] – 9 October 464[5]), formally Empress Wenmu (文穆皇后, literally "the civil and solemn empress"), was an empress of the Chinese Liu Song dynasty. Her husband was Emperor Xiaowu (Liu Jun).

  1. ^ Lady Liu's birth year and her age when she died were not recorded. However, it is likely that she was born in or after 443 as that was the year her parents married.
  2. ^ According to Emperor Ming's biography in Book of Song, Lady Liu and her brother Liu Zishang were ordered to commit suicide on the jiwei day of the 11th month of the 1st year of the Yongguang era. This corresponds to 2 Jan 466 in the Julian calendar. ([永光元年十一月]己未,司徒扬州刺史豫章王子尚、山阴公主并赐死。) Song Shu, vol.08
  3. ^ According to Liu Zishang's biography in Book of Song, he was 16 (by East Asian reckoning) when he died. (太宗殒废帝,称太皇后令曰:“子尚顽凶极悖,行乖天理。楚玉淫乱纵慝,义绝人经。并可于第赐尽。”子尚时年十六。) Song Shu, vol.80. Thus, his birth year should be 451.
  4. ^ Lady Wang's biography in Book of Song indicated that she was 38 (by East Asian reckoning) when she died.
  5. ^ jichou day of the 8th month of the 8th year of the Da'ming era, per volume 129 of Zizhi Tongjian
